About Flemming Bjerrum
Flemming Bjerrum is a scholar working on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Physiology, Biomedical Engineering and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, having authored 74 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Surgical Simulation and Training (58 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(7 papers),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(6 papers), Anatomy and Medical Technology (4 papers), Augmented Reality Applications (3 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(2 papers), Endometriosis Research and Treatment (1 paper) and Gynecological conditions and treatments (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Surgery (982 citations), Human-Computer Interaction (123 citations), Family Practice (16 citations), Physiology (174 citations) and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(133 citations). Flemming Bjerrum has collaborated with scholars based in Denmark,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Lars Konge, Stine Maya Dreier Sørensen, Ismail Gögenür, Jette Led Sørensen, Jeanett Strandbygaard, Anders Meller Donatsky, Ann Sofia Skou Thomsen, Bent Ottesen, Morten Bo Søndergaard Svendsen and Steven Arild Wuyts Andersen. Their work appears in journals such as Surgical Endoscopy, Journal of surgical education, Annals of Surgery, Acta Obstetricia Et Gynecologica Scandinavica and The American Journal of Surgery.
